After Move To Miami, Ivanka Trump, Kushner Rent Condo: Report

Transitioning from Washington, DC to Florida, Trump and Kushner are renting a condo at Arte in the Surfside neighborhood, reports said.

MIAMI, FL — Now that Pres. Donald Trump has left office and his family is relocating to South Florida, his daughter Ivanka Trump and son-in-law/senior presidential adviser Jared Kushner are renting a luxury condo in Miami, The Real Deal reported.

The couple will rent a condo at Arte, designed by Antonio Citterio, in Miami’s exclusive Surfside neighborhood, reports said.

Construction of the oceanfront building at 8955 Collins Ave., which was developed by Alex Sapir, was completed last year. The 12-story building with 16 units features an outdoor pool, indoor lap pool, a spa and fitness center, a tennis court, residents’ lounge, and air-conditioned parking, reports said.

In December, the couple also picked up a $32 million waterfront lot on Indian Creek Island, referred to as “Billionaire’s Bunker.”

The Trump family is staking its claim in South Florida. The former president moved into his private Mar-a-Lago Club in Palm Beach Wednesday during Pres. Joe Biden’s inauguration.

His son, Donald Trump Jr., and girlfriend, Kimberly Guilfoyle, are also moving to Florida, Florida Politics reported. They’re considering relocating to Jupiter.

And the president’s other daughter, Tiffany Trump, who has been spending time in Miami with her fiancé, Nigerian businessman Michael Boulos, is reportedly looking for a home in Miami Beach.

Some members of Kushner’s family have also moved to South Florida. His brother, Joshua Kushner, and sister-in-law, model Karlie Kloss, purchased a $23.5 million Miami Beach mansion in December.
